YOUR IMPACT

We are looking for an Associate to serve as a member of the Marcus US Deposits Business Controls and Risk Management function in Richardson (Texas). The role will execute key control deliverables related to issues management, risk reporting and control assessments, to ensure regulatory compliance, protecting client assets, and managing risk.

HOW YOU WILL FULFILL YOUR POTENTIAL

ROLE REQUIREMENTS
  • Proactively identify business risks, process deficiencies, and potential gaps/weaknesses in risk management practices.
  • Present outcomes of gap assessment and remediation to leadership.
  • Pre-empt 2

    LOD/3

    LOD engagements by proactively reviewing process documentation (process maps, procedures, etc.) and working with stakeholders to identify existing controls, identify control gaps (automation, detective reporting, etc.) and ensure that risks are sufficiently mitigated.
  • Actively participate in cross-functional working groups to reconcile engineering roadmaps and daily intake requests, ensuring all prioritized initiatives are seamlessly aligned with the PRC Change Management framework.
  • Lead cross-functional 2

    LOD/3

    LOD engagement efforts across the business.
  • Work closely with stakeholders to map change management activities to reporting requirements, preparing bi-weekly impact assessments and supporting ad-hoc audit deliverables.
  • Head continuous change management improvements by compiling and delivering daily risk escalations, monthly performance reports, and organic growth metrics to executive audiences.
  • Maintain effective communication with other teams to facilitate weekly executive approval meetings, resolve past-due tickets, and shepherd the implementation of corrective actions for non-compliance with policies and procedures to ensure timely resolution.
  • Contribute to executive reporting and other data-driven deliverables, with a focus on providing appropriate content, context, and structure in a precise and timely manner.
